George Soros is the founder of Soros Fund Management and one of the most famous macro investors in modern markets. He is best known for large global bets informed by his theory of reflexivity, including the 1992 sterling trade. Though the firm later evolved as a family office, its equity filings and historical track record remain a reference point for students of macro and activist-era hedge funds.

George Soros's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, George Soros held 320 positions worth $6.16B, up 41% from $4.37B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.

George Soros deployed $1.2B of net new capital in Q1 2018, opening 120 new positions and adding to 40 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was VICI Properties: 21,498,926 shares worth $394M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 18% of assets, down from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Alerian MLP ETF, an estimated $35.9M trimmed.
